Creekside at Stinson Beach – a truly unique property on a nice quarter-acre of land that melds sweetly into the woods of the neighboring national park lands. Unlike many houses at Stinson, neighboring houses are on one fence only, so the place is quite private. The house is in its own wonderful watershed, almost a little micro-climate, yet only 100 yards from the 3 mile sandy beach. It's a 4-minute walk to the town's three restaurants, the library, market and boutiques.

Available for week-long rentals (half-week rates available sometimes), this charming, classic two-story house features knotty pine ceilings, hard wood floors, a wood stove upstairs, radiant heated tiles floors downstairs, top-of-the-line spa steps from the downstairs bedroom, views of the ocean, three bedrooms and two baths.
It is located next to a lovely fresh water creek teeming with native plants and visited by wildlife, including deer, foxes, bats, ducks, grebes, egrets, hawks, warblers, flycatchers and many others. In March of 2009 we witnessed a 20' steelhead trout spawning below our dining room window! During the summer of 2009 a 3-point buck and doe were living nearby and visited most evenings. Later we enjoyed their fawns running around.
The house is on quarter acre that borders the north end of the Golden Gate National Recreation Area Stinson Beach Park so it feels like you are on a very large piece of land.
